v0 by Vercel: Design-First AI App Building
Learn every v0 feature and build production-quality React apps from text prompts. Master the credit system, Figma-to-code workflow, and one-click Vercel deployment. Free 8-lesson course with certificate.
The UI-First Builder
Everyone’s talking about AI app builders. But most of them generate code that looks like a junior developer’s first week on the job — functional, but ugly. The kind of code you’d rewrite from scratch before showing a senior engineer.
v0 is different. It thinks in React, writes in TypeScript, styles with Tailwind CSS, and builds with shadcn/ui components. The output isn’t just functional — it’s the kind of code a senior frontend developer would actually approve in a code review.
The catch? v0’s credit system is dollar-based and unpredictable. A complex prompt on the Max model can burn through your free $5 in a single session. Meanwhile, smart builders are shipping complete apps on the free tier — because they know which model to use and when.
This course teaches you the model tiers, the prompting techniques, and the design-first workflow that separates frustrated beginners from productive builders. By the end, you’ll have a polished app on a live Vercel URL — and the skills to build the next one for a fraction of the credits.
What You'll Learn
- Use v0 to generate a production-quality React component from a single text prompt
- Explain how the credit system works and apply model-tier strategies to reduce costs
- Apply design-first prompting techniques with Tailwind CSS steering and shadcn/ui components
- Build a complete web application UI component by component using the iterative v0 workflow
- Use the Figma-to-code pipeline to turn visual designs into working React code
- Design a full app from concept to deployed Vercel URL using the v0 workflow
After This Course, You Can
What You'll Build
Course Syllabus
Who Is This For?
- Designers who want to turn visual ideas into working code without learning React
- Non-technical founders who need beautiful MVPs fast — and care about code quality
- Freelancers and solopreneurs building client-facing apps and landing pages
- Anyone curious about AI app builders who wants the best UI output quality
- Lovable or Bolt.new users who want to explore a design-first, frontend-focused alternative
- Career changers adding frontend development skills without a coding bootcamp
Frequently Asked Questions
Do I need to know React or JavaScript?
No. v0 generates all the code for you. This course is designed for complete beginners. Knowing a few Tailwind CSS classes helps (we teach you the important ones), but it's not required.
How much does v0 cost?
v0 has a free tier with $5 in credits. This course teaches you how to stretch those credits using the Mini model tier. Paid plans start at $20/month.
How long does this course take?
About 2.5 hours total. Each lesson is 15-20 minutes. Work through it all at once or one lesson per day.
Will I build a real app?
Yes. By the end, you'll have a fully designed and deployed web application on a live Vercel URL you can share with anyone.